Lines Matching defs:len
135 segumap_verify_safe(caddr_t kaddr, size_t len)
151 VERIFY(seg->s_base + seg->s_size >= kaddr + len);
177 segumap_unmap(struct seg *seg, caddr_t addr, size_t len)
184 if (addr != seg->s_base || len != seg->s_size) {
194 hat_unload(seg->s_as->a_hat, addr, len, HAT_UNLOAD_UNMAP);
215 segumap_fault(struct hat *hat, struct seg *seg, caddr_t addr, size_t len,
229 size_t plen = btop(len);
260 size_t nval = sud->sud_softlockcnt + btop(len);
283 segumap_setprot(struct seg *seg, caddr_t addr, size_t len, uint_t prot)
295 segumap_checkprot(struct seg *seg, caddr_t addr, size_t len, uint_t prot)
312 segumap_sync(struct seg *seg, caddr_t addr, size_t len, int attr, uint_t flags)
320 segumap_incore(struct seg *seg, caddr_t addr, size_t len, char *vec)
326 len = (len + PAGEOFFSET) & PAGEMASK;
327 while (len > 0) {
331 len -= PAGESIZE;
338 segumap_lockop(struct seg *seg, caddr_t addr, size_t len, int attr, int op,
346 segumap_getprot(struct seg *seg, caddr_t addr, size_t len, uint_t *protv)
361 pgno = seg_page(seg, addr + len) - seg_page(seg, addr) + 1;
402 segumap_advise(struct seg *seg, caddr_t addr, size_t len, uint_t behav)
424 segumap_pagelock(struct seg *seg, caddr_t addr, size_t len, struct page ***ppp,
432 segumap_setpagesize(struct seg *seg, caddr_t addr, size_t len, uint_t szc)